Special Education (A.S.T.) TTP


Special Education
Associate of Science in Teaching

 

Students should check with the university to which they intend to transfer in case there are additional requirements needed for admittance to the Special Education Program. Students transferring to UTK need to be formally admitted to the program during semester four.

Additional A.S.T. degree requirements:

  • Attainment of a 2.75 cumulative GPA
  • ACT score of 21 or successful completion of the PRAXIS CORE exam (MTSU and UTC require a 22 ACT score)
  • Satisfactory ratings on an index of suitability for the teaching profession

Semester Hours Credit: 60 (or see notes below)


All special education majors who are required to take Learning Support must also complete MSCC 1300 First-Year Experience , and the degree program will require 63 credit hours.
